Grounds Maintenance Services
Rushden Town Council (the Council) is seeking tenders from suitably qualified organisations for the supply of a flexible and responsive Grounds Maintenance Service.Rushden has a population of 30,000 and has been designated as a growth town.
Rushden has seen significant development over the last 20 years, resulting in 42 parks and open spaces now being owned by the Council.
The Council also owns and administers a large cemetery and is responsible for the closed Parish church yard.
The parks and open spaces owned by the Council vary from small LAPs and LEAPs to a prestigious Green Flag 34 acre park.
A number of the parks are of mixed use and include playing fields and sports pitches.
The parks are home to a large quantity of mature, specimen trees and established hedges.
The Council also undertakes grass cutting in roadside verges for the principal authority.
